Editorial note

The BMW M4 (2022) is a car that stands out for its exceptional performance, thanks to a powerful engine and precision engineering. Users will appreciate the unparalleled driving experience it offers, whether on the road or on the track. Additionally, its intuitive infotainment system and innovative driving aids ensure safety and comfort, contributing to an overall very positive user experience. The sporty and elegant design of the M4 is also worth mentioning. Its aerodynamic lines are not only aesthetic; they also enhance the car's performance. Inside, the cabin is designed with high-quality materials, providing appreciable comfort for the driver and passengers, even though the rear space is somewhat limited. However, the BMW M4 (2022) has some drawbacks. Its high fuel consumption and high purchase price can make this model less accessible to a wide audience. Furthermore, maintenance costs can be significant, particularly due to the specificity of replacement parts. Finally, the stiff suspension, while improving handling, can make driving less enjoyable on poorly maintained roads. In summary, the BMW M4 (2022) is a car that will delight performance and design enthusiasts, but it requires a significant investment and may pose space issues for families.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I convert miles to kilometers?
One mile is equal to 1.609344 kilometers, while one kilometer is equivalent to 0.62137119 miles.
How can I locate the VIN number of my BMW?
The location of the VIN number varies depending on the make and model of the car. This code may be engraved or affixed to the chassis. To find its exact position on your BMW {item}, please refer to the manual.
What is the VIN number?
The VIN number is a unique identifier assigned to each vehicle. The acronym VIN stands for Vehicle Identification Number.
How often should I have my BMW serviced?
It is essential to perform regular maintenance on your vehicle. The maintenance manual indicates the recommended frequency of services as well as specific items to check. Generally, a thorough service is advised every 2 years or after 30,000 kilometers.
When should I replace the brake fluid in my BMW?
It is recommended to replace the brake fluid every two years.
What is the difference between E10 and E5 gasoline?
E10 gasoline contains up to 10% ethanol, while E5 contains less than 5%. Therefore, E10 has a lower gasoline percentage than E5, making it more environmentally friendly.
